Description

This beautifully presented home boasts an attractive brick façade, tiled roof and a recently landscaped front driveway for a modern finish. A sheltered porch entrance leads into a stylishly extended interior with the added benefit of an integrated garage area featuring a roller shutter door.

At the heart of the home is a spacious open-plan kitchen, dining, and living area, flooded with natural light from a skylight and aluminium bi-folding doors, which open out seamlessly to the garden. The contemporary kitchen offers sleek dark cabinetry, a central island, and a tile backsplash, while the cosy front lounge features a charming brick fireplace with a wood-burning stove.

Upstairs, the bedrooms are well-proportioned and equipped with built-in storage. The bathroom is finished to a high standard with grey panelling, a vanity unit, and a shower over the bath.

The rear of the property showcases a modern single-storey extension, opening out to a landscaped, multi-level garden with a stone patio, lawn, and raised beds – ideal for entertaining.

Perfect for commuters, the property sits on the main road offering direct transport links to Manchester, with Burnley Manchester Road train station just 1.6km away and multiple bus routes within walking distance. Local schools including Christ the King RC Primary and Rosewood Primary are also nearby, along with shops, restaurants, and leisure facilities — making this an ideal home for families and professionals alike.
